SerDes Design and Validation Engineer
Apple is looking for a Ser Des Design and Validation Engineer to Lead system validation of mixed-signal Ser Des IP. In this highly visible role, you will contribute to the design, integration and validation of high-performance analog and mixed-signal circuits for Ser Des PHY applications. This encompasses the design and optimization of critical building blocks such as receivers, transmitters, bias generators, high-speed clock generation and distribution networks targeting best-in-class power, performance, and area metrics. A key part of your design responsibilities will include the development of analog DFT circuits and techniques essential for comprehensive PHY validation. You will develop test plans, review and analyze data to guarantee a robust IP design. You will drive and work closely with production test (e.g. ATE, system validation) teams and debug complex design and system bring-up issues.

Description:
In this role, the key responsibilities are the following:
Ownership of Ser Des system bring-up, validation and debug. This will involve a Ser Des bring up in system environment, verifying basic operations, analyzing robustness and margins in system.
Work with design teams to understand the architecture and define DFT needs to help enhance testability and first-time silicon success.
Be involved in mixed-signal verification tasks to better understand the Ser Des operation and interaction with higher level control logic.
Preferred Qualifications:
The ideal candidate should have experience in high-speed serial links with expertise in the following:
Solid understanding and experience of designing analog mixed signal circuit blocks including Bandgap, biasing circuits, LDO regulators, amplifiers, comparators, switched-cap circuits, ADCs, DACs, Oscillators, Filters.
Solid understanding of analog mixed-signal concepts like mismatch mitigation, linearity, stability, low-power and low-noise techniques.
Solid understanding and experience with digitally assisted analog design concepts (e.g. background calibrations, LMS based adaptive loops).
Hands-on experience to drive lab and production testing, debug, and data analysis
Hands-on experience with AMS IC development from definition to high-volume production including layout supervision, bench evaluation, correlation, and characterization.
Skills in scripting and automation to enhance efficiency are highly desirable.
Experience in high-speed serial links, with knowledge of common high-speed Ser Des protocols like PCIe, USB, DP, and MPHY.
Knowledge of Tx/Rx equalization techniques and circuits, including CTLE, DFE, and de-emphasis, as well as CDR architectures and implementations.
Knowledge of common high-speed Ser Des protocols (e.g., PCIe, USB, DP, MPHY) is highly desired.
Exposure to firmware assisted mixed signal IP development is desirable.
Knowledge and inquisitiveness in AI/ML domains, and ability to apply the concepts for improved silicon performance, and also for productivity improvements in the design/validation of the IP
Minimum Qualifications:
BS and a minimum of 10 years relevant industry experience.
